Here is this antique kitchen item that appears to be a miniature churn. This item measures 7″ in height when the dasher is depressed and 2″ in diameter. The body is made of birch bark. This holds water and the top fits tightly. I believe that this was a functional item when it was made, and not meant to be a toy, for say a doll. The graining on the top and bottom is beautiful. It has a shellac that is even. The dasher has holes in the bottom circular part. The birch bark is held with hand cut brass staples/pins. There are three bands to stabilize the circular body shape.
